About Scholarship: The Center for International Media Ethics (CIME) is a non-profit organization bringing together a network of media professionals throughout the world to provide training, discussion and expertise in the ethics of their profession. Our driving emphasis is that media professionals take responsibility in shaping society. After the success of the 2012 CIME Fellowship programme, we are looking for media professionals for the next round of the Fellowship from anywhere in the world. Ideal candidates should be interested in the ethical aspects of journalism and eager to deepen their knowledge about media ethics through involvement with CIME’s activities.

Duration: 1 year, starting January 2013 
Eligibility:
-Minimum 3 years of professional experience related to journalism/media Strong interest in media ethics
-Proven track record of commitment to ethical issues in journalism (2 brief essays (800 words maximum) on addressing ethical issues of the media, attached to the application)
-Fluent in English, both oral and written; other languages are an asset
-Excellent communication skills Computer literacy, with good working knowledge of word processing, e-mail and internet applications.
-Must own computer and permanent access to internet (this is an entirely online Fellowship)
